
Do you ever wonder how people find your website on the internet and what they viewed while there? There are a lot of ways people actually reach your website - from search engines, to social media and social networks, to offsite advertisements. Google Analytics is a web-based software solution that will show you all these - and best of all - it is totally FREE and easy to incorporate into your website!
It will help you monitor your site traffic, making it easier for you to improve your website in terms of investment, conversions, and monetizing your site.
Recently Google released their new Analytics administration portal which makes it easier to manage and analyse website data. In particular there are 3 new features that we think are top notch for business owners and marketing teams:
Real-Time Reporting
Almost everyone uses the internet now - a statement of the obvious! With Google Analytics, you can view your reports in real-time. This will show you your site traffic as it happens. Social media is also a huge factor currently in site traffic. It is a good practice for companies to post to their social media account if their website has new content. So with this new feature, you will see how much site traffic you get from sending your new site content through a tweet, for example. The Real Time Reporting will also show you the effectiveness of your new campaigns.
Mobile Reporting
With the rise of the smart phones, more and more people now are using their mobile phones to browse the internet. People can access the internet anytime, anywhere because of this. With Google Analytics’ Mobile reporting, you can now see how mobile users are using your site. You can even see what mobile phone models they are using in visiting your site or what their service providers are.
This is a super important feature if you are looking at upgrading your website - most standard websites are pretty mobile unfriendly with lots of scrolling and zooming to get around the screen. So if you want to analyse what percentage of your visitors are using mobiles and understand how a 'mobile ready' version of your new website will be used, this is THE key feature.
Flow Visualisation
Finally Google Analytics has also improved their path analysis tools. Flow Visualisation will help you view your site reports graphically, thus making it easier for you to interpret your reports. You can either view your reports in Visitors Flow, or in Goal Flow. Visitors flow will basically show you your site visitors’ journey through your website (sneaky), while Goal Flow will show you your site visitors’ activities as they go through your goal steps - this is extremely important to find out at what point your convert or loose leads.
